What Is an MRI Scan? 

Magnetic Resonance Imaging (MRI) is a non-invasive imaging technique that uses powerful magnetic fields and radio waves to create high-resolution images of the internal structures of the body. Unlike X-rays or CT scans, MRI does not use ionizing radiation, making it a safer option for many patients. 

Common Uses of MRI Scans 

MRI scans are versatile and can be used for various diagnostic purposes, including: 

  • Brain and Spinal Cord Imaging: MRIs are highly effective for diagnosing neurological conditions such as multiple sclerosis, brain tumors, and spinal cord injuries. 
  • Musculoskeletal Diagnosis: They help detect joint injuries, ligament tears, and soft tissue abnormalities. 
  • Tumor and Cancer Diagnosis: MRIs can identify and monitor tumors in organs such as the liver, kidneys, and prostate. 
  • Cardiac Imaging: Specialized cardiac MRIs evaluate heart structure and function, helping to detect conditions like heart disease or congenital heart defects. 

Benefits of MRI Scans 

  • Non-invasive and painless. 
  • Exceptional image clarity for soft tissues. 
  • Useful for both diagnostic and treatment planning. 

What Is a CT Scan? 

Computed Tomography (CT) scans use a combination of X-rays and advanced computer algorithms to generate cross-sectional images of the body. These scans provide a comprehensive view of internal organs, bones, and blood vessels, making them indispensable in emergency and diagnostic medicine. 

Common Uses of CT Scans 

  • Emergency Diagnostics: CT scans are often used in trauma cases to quickly assess internal injuries and bleeding. 
  • Cancer Detection: They help detect and stage cancers, providing a clear view of tumor size and spread. 
  • Infection and Inflammation: CT scans are useful in identifying conditions like appendicitis, pneumonia, and abscesses. 
  • Pre-Surgical Planning: Surgeons rely on CT scans to map out anatomical details before procedures. 

Advantages of CT Scans 

  • Rapid imaging, often completed within minutes. 
  • Detailed visualization of complex structures like blood vessels and organs. 
  • Effective for monitoring disease progression or treatment outcomes. 

What Is a DEXA Scan? 

Dual-Energy X-ray Absorptiometry (DEXA) scans are specialized X-rays used primarily to measure bone density. They are a gold standard for diagnosing osteoporosis and assessing fracture risk, particularly in older adults or individuals with a family history of bone-related conditions. 

Common Uses of DEXA Scans 

  • Osteoporosis Diagnosis: Detects early signs of bone thinning, enabling timely intervention. 
  • Fracture Risk Assessment: Identifies individuals at higher risk of fractures due to weak bones. 
  • Tracking Bone Health: Useful for monitoring the effectiveness of osteoporosis treatments over time. 

Benefits of DEXA Scans 

  • Non-invasive and quick (usually takes about 15-20 minutes). 
  • Minimal radiation exposure. 
  • Provides critical data for managing bone health effectively.
